Compare Menomonee Falls to Madison

This post compares Menomonee Falls, Wisconsin to Madison, Wisconsin across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Menomonee Falls (village) Madison (city)
Population 36,411 248,856
Income (median) $57,422 $50,233
Home Value (median) $235,300 $223,300
White 89% 78%
Black 3% 6%
Asian 5% 8%
With Kids 28% 21%
Age (median) 43 31
Rentals 25% 52%
